Job Description

KeyResponsibilities:

  • Facilitate LLM API (e.g., GPT, Claude) for enterprise use cases.
  • Collaborate with business team to integrate GenAI into workflow and automation process such as document processing, document triage, quotation, claim, underwriting etc.
  • Develop and maintain enterprise-level document RAG and LLM Knowledge Base.
  • Lead behavior-driven design and spec-driven development principle, AI coding, AI testing and provide framework support and guidance to both business team and IT team.
  • Develop AI Agent skills and AI-driven tools to improve data quality, documentation, logic traceability, reduce technical debt and modernize AIOps.
  • Optimize prompt engineering and context engineering strategies for accuracy, relevance, and performance.
  • Implement secure and scalable inference pipelines using Azure or AWS.
  • Monitor model outputs for bias, hallucination, and compliance with Zurich’s security standards.
  • Ensure AI applications comply with Zurich’s data protection and privacy policies, including handling of PII and consented data.
  • Support GenAI workshops and internal enablement initiatives to promote AI adoption.

Your Skills and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s in Computer Science, AI Engineering, or related field.
  • Experience in deploying AI models into production environments.
  • Proficiency in Python and TypeScript programming languages, and familiar with Langchain framework and Vecel AI toolkit.
  • Familiarity with LLMs (e.g., GPT, Claude) APIs, prompt tuning, and GenAI deployment.
  • Familiarity with spec-driven development framework such as OpenSpec and GitHub Spec-Kit.
  • Strong understanding of enterprise application architecture and integration points.
  • Knowledge of data privacy, compliance, and ethical AI standards.
  • Familiarity with DevOps tools and containerization technologies, such as Jenkins, Azure Pipeline, GitHub Actions,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Proficiency with Git and GitHub workflows.
  • Knowledge of cloud platforms and services, such as AWS and Azure, as well as experience in managing cloud-based infrastructure.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ication, documentation and collaboration skills, as well as the ability to work effectively in cross-functional teams.
  • A deep understanding of agile methodologies and principles.
  • Familiarity with security best practices and the ability to implement security measures in the software development lifecycle.
  • A commitment to continuous learning and staying up-to-date with the latest industry trends and technologies.
  • Self-motivated, proactive and responsible.
  • Proficiency in English reading and writing skills, and the ability to use either English or Cantonese speaking as a working language.

About Zurich Insurance

Zurich Insurance Group (Zurich) is a leading global multi-line insurer founded more than 150 years ago, which has grown into a business serving more than 75 million customers in more than 200 countries and territories, while delivering industry-leading total shareholder returns. Our customers include individuals, small businesses, and mid-sized and large companies, as well as multinational corporations. The Group is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land, where it was founded in 1872.
